Table of Contents
In the rapidly evolving landscape of artificial intelligence, Playground AI's API has emerged as a powerful tool for developers and tech teams seeking to integrate advanced AI functionalities into their applications. This guide provides a comprehensive overview of how to explore and utilize Playground AI's API effectively.
Understanding Playground AI's API
Playground AI's API offers a flexible interface for accessing state-of-the-art AI models. It enables developers to generate text, analyze data, and build intelligent features with ease. The API is designed with simplicity and scalability in mind, making it suitable for projects of all sizes.
Getting Started with API Access
To begin exploring the API, developers need to obtain an API key. This involves creating an account on the Playground AI platform and subscribing to a suitable plan. Once registered, users can generate their API credentials from the dashboard.
Making Your First API Call
Using tools like cURL or Postman, you can send requests to the API endpoint. A typical request includes specifying the model, providing input data, and setting parameters such as temperature and max tokens. Example:
curl -X POST https://api.playgroundai.com/v1/generate \n-H "Authorization: Bearer YOUR_API_KEY" \n-d '{"model": "text-davinci-002", "prompt": "Hello, world!", "max_tokens": 50}'
Key Features of Playground AI's API
- Multiple Models: Access a variety of AI models optimized for different tasks.
- Customizable Parameters: Fine-tune outputs with temperature, top_p, and max_tokens settings.
- Streaming Responses: Receive real-time output as the model generates text.
- Secure Authentication: Use API keys to ensure secure access.
Best Practices for Developers
To maximize the effectiveness of Playground AI's API, consider the following best practices:
- Implement error handling to manage rate limits and network issues.
- Use environment variables to store API keys securely.
- Optimize prompt design to improve output relevance.
- Monitor API usage to stay within plan limits and manage costs.
Integrating API into Applications
Developers can incorporate Playground AI's API into web or mobile applications using programming languages like Python, JavaScript, or others. Example in Python:
import requests\n\nheaders = {\n 'Authorization': 'Bearer YOUR_API_KEY',\n 'Content-Type': 'application/json',\n}\n\ndata = {\n 'model': 'text-davinci-002',\n 'prompt': 'Explain quantum physics in simple terms.',\n 'max_tokens': 150,\n}\n\nresponse = requests.post('https://api.playgroundai.com/v1/generate', headers=headers, json=data)\nprint(response.json())
Security and Privacy Considerations
When using Playground AI's API, ensure that API keys are kept confidential. Use secure storage solutions and avoid exposing keys in client-side code. Additionally, review data privacy policies to understand how input and output data are handled.
Conclusion
Playground AI's API is a versatile and powerful resource for integrating advanced AI capabilities into diverse projects. By understanding its features, best practices, and integration methods, developers and tech teams can leverage this tool to enhance their applications and innovate effectively in the AI space.